Vibration through handle bars?
« on: 01 April 2012, 04:41:44 am »
Hi all, I have just brought a fazer 1000 2001. I have noticed a slight vibration through the standard handle bars? Can it e cured with replacing the bars? The standard ones still have the weights fitted

Hi and welcome :)

Slight vibes are pretty normal and can't be eradicated completely by changing the bars, end weights or whatever.  That said, the standard bars often get changed for Renthals (758s are the most popular) because the latter are stronger and have a more comfortable drawback angle.

The earlier models were a bit more buzzy at certain revs than later ones.  Yamaha set the fuelling a bit lean at part throttle which can cause lean surge and vibes.  This can be improved with a bit of carb work.

You can keep vibes to a minimum by synching the carbs and generally making sure that the bike is well-serviced and set up as it should be.
